Tribune News Service

Chandigarh, May 30

A 40-year-old man today committed suicide by hanging himself at his house in Sector 7.

According to the police, the deceased has been identified as Bir Singh. The victim was rushed to the hospital where he was declared brought dead. The police said though no suicide note was recovered from the spot, they had ruled out foul play in the incident.
